Material Engineering for Mower Blades

Material selection is critical in determining a blade’s wear resistance, toughness, and rust protection. Troy mower blades utilize a variety of engineered materials to meet specific operational requirements:

Material Key Properties Ideal Applications
SK5 High hardness, excellent wear resistance Heavy-duty brush cutting
65Mn Balanced elasticity and toughness High-impact scenarios
Stainless Steel Excellent corrosion resistance High-humidity or coastal environments
40MnB High strength and hardness, good toughness, excellent hardenability Medium-duty mowing, similar to American 10B38 grade

These materials undergo precision heat treatment processes, including quenching, tempering, and cryogenic treatments where applicable, to enhance edge retention and mechanical properties. The result is a mower blade that maintains sharpness even under continuous operation.

Structural Geometry and Customization

The geometry of a mower blade significantly influences its cutting efficiency and performance. Troy mower blades feature customizable structures to suit specific mower types and cutting environments:

  • Custom Hole Designs: Blades can be produced with triangular, oval, or other non-standard apertures to fit various mounting mechanisms.
  • Non-Standard Edge Angles: Dual-angle or multi-angle blade configurations can be engineered to optimize cutting quality and reduce vibration.
  • Thickness Customization: Precise thickness control, such as 5.3 mm ±0.05 mm for high-speed equipment, ensures blade stability and performance in demanding applications.

The combination of geometric precision and material strength allows Troy mower blades to reduce energy consumption during operation and extend the lifespan of both the blade and the mower itself.

Surface Finishing and Coatings

Surface treatment enhances blade longevity by reducing friction, preventing corrosion, and improving wear resistance. Troy mower blades offer a range of finishing options:

Surface Treatment Purpose Notes
Teflon Coating Reduces friction, prevents grass sticking Suitable for wet conditions
Titanium Nitride (TiN) Coating Improves hardness and edge retention Enhances durability
Black Oxide Mild anti-corrosion Economical choice for standard use
Polishing Options Mirror polish, vibratory polish, electrolytic polish Improves cutting smoothness and blade balance
Anti-Rust Treatments Oil coating, vacuum plating, eco-friendly packaging Extends storage and operational life

These finishing processes ensure that Troy mower blades remain effective in diverse environments while providing a clean, precise cut.
